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Langwith-Whaley Thorns to East Dulwich start from as little as £17.70

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Langwith-Whaley Thorns to East Dulwich start from £57.20 one way

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Langwith-Whaley Thorns to East Dulwich are available for £116.20 one way

Split ticketing means that instead of purchasing one rail ticket for your journey we automatically find and help you book two or more tickets instead, covering exactly the same journey. We call it our FairSplit.

Everything you need to know about Langwith-Whaley Thorns Station

Exploring Langwith-Whaley Thorns Station

Langwith-Whaley Thorns railway station, nestled in Derbyshire, England, serves the quaint area of Langwith. If you're planning on visiting this charming locale, or perhaps just looking to travel from this station, you're in for a modest yet seamless experience. Being part of the East Midlands Railway network, the station ensures connectivity with several notable destinations across the country.

The station is equipped with the essential amenities required for a smooth journey. While it lacks a traditional ticket office, there are accessible ticket machines available for collecting tickets purchased online. It's worth noting that Langwith-Whaley Thorns embraces accessibility, offering step-free access through ramps on both platforms for ease of passage.

Facilities and Accessibility at Langwith-Whaley Thorns

For travelers needing assistance, Langwith-Whaley Thorns has a customer help point and offers basic support for passengers with impairments, albeit without a staffed help desk. Despite its absence of seating areas and waiting rooms, the station provides CCTV-equipped safety and a free car park, operated by East Midlands Railway, accessible around the clock.

Interestingly, while smartcards aren't issued at the station, validators are present. This small yet vital feature manifests the ongoing efforts to modernize the service and improve convenience. However, if you're expecting refreshments, personal comforts, or bicycle storage, these are not available on-site, so plan accordingly.

Everything you need to know about East Dulwich Station

Welcome to East Dulwich Station

Tucked away in the charming borough of Southwark, East Dulwich station is your gateway to a vibrant community that effortlessly marries the quaint with the cosmopolitan. Serving as a crucial link for commuters and casual explorers alike, this station is a hub of activity day in and day out. Whether you're starting your journey in one of London's quieter enclaves or heading toward the hustle and bustle of the city, East Dulwich is a key point of departure and arrival for countless travellers.

At East Dulwich Station, ticket purchasing is straightforward and convenient. The ticket office is operational from as early as 5:40 AM on weekdays, with slightly adjusted hours over the weekend. For those who prefer to handle things digitally, there are ticket machines available for use that support smartcard validation as well. Accessibility is a priority, with machines designed to accommodate travellers with disabilities, although it's recommended to review the station map or step-free access section in advance. The station is also equipped with an induction loop for those with hearing impairments, ensuring a smooth experience for all visitors.

Travel Assistance and Accessibility

Help is never far away at East Dulwich, thanks to the presence of staff and multiple customer help points. Station staff are typically available throughout the day to provide assistance, whether pre-booked or on a walk-up basis. While there aren't tactile surfaces along all platform edges, the station does offer ramps longer than 400m to both platform 1 and platform 2, along with a staff-operated ramp for access from the train to the platform. Moreover, if assistance is needed, there's a freephone number, textphone, and of course, on-site staff to assist with any mobility concerns. It should be noted that East Dulwich station lacks accessible toilets and a waiting room, although seating areas are provided.

Amenities and Onward Travel

In terms of amenities, East Dulwich offers no on-site refreshment facilities or shopping options, so stock up before you arrive! Cyclists have access to 16 bike stands near platform 1, though they must be prepared to rely on their own security measures as these stands are unsheltered. Access to public Wi-Fi is unavailable, but pay phones are on site should you need to make a call.
